The Old Farmer’s Almanac recommends planting irises in mid- to late summer.Farmers’ Almanac releases Pacific Northwest’s 2024 … Video / Aug 8, 2023 / 02:06 PM PDT This prediction includes plenty of snow for the entire West Coast, the publication says.A frost date is the average date of the last light freeze in spring or the first light freeze in fall. The classification of freeze temperatures is based on their effect on plants: Light freeze: 29° to 32°F (-1.7° to 0°C)—tender plants are killed. Moderate freeze: 25° to 28°F (-3.9° to -2.2°C)—widely destructive to most vegetation.The 12-Month Long-Range Weather Report From The 2024 Old Farmer's Almanac. November 2023 to October 2024. Here are some winter 2018-2019 highlights: A late January Arctic blast resulted in Chicago having subzero temperatures for 52 straight hours. No all-time records were broken in the Windy City, but the low temperature of -23°F was close to breaking the all-time record of -27°F. On January 29th, Chicago’s wind chill dipped to -52°F!…

The average temperature for the contiguous US for meteorological summer 2022 (June 1- August 31), was 73.9 degrees F, 2.5 degrees above average. (The summers of 2021 and 1936 are the two other hottest summers on record, with the summer of 2021 beating the Dust Bowl summer by less than .01 degrees F, with the average temperature coming in at 74 ...
